Jaka jest przyszłość aplikacji mobilnych?

Opublikowany: 2022-12-15

Jaka jest przyszłość aplikacji mobilnych? Tutaj znajdziesz najnowsze trendy, w tym IoT, Swift, rozwój międzyplatformowy i nie tylko.

Według raportu Statista za II kwartał 2021 roku użytkownicy aplikacji pobrali około 28,9 miliarda aplikacji ze sklepu Google Play i około 7,9 miliona z App Store. Ponadto w roku 2022 użytkownicy w USA będą wydawać około 35 miliardów dolarów i więcej na aplikacje ze sklepów z aplikacjami.

Każdy właściciel smartfona ma na swoim smartfonie około 35 lub więcej aplikacji. Niektóre z nich są usuwane z powodu problemów z wydajnością. Ale nic nie stoi na przeszkodzie szybkiemu rozwojowi aplikacji mobilnych. Przewiduje się, że globalne przychody aplikacji w wysokości około 581 miliardów dolarów w 2020 roku wzrosną do blisko 800 miliardów dolarów w 2022 roku.

Jak widać z tych liczb, coraz więcej firm i startupów tworzy aplikacje mobilne, aby pomóc swoim firmom.

Dodatkowo zwiększyło to konkurencyjność na rynku tworzenia aplikacji mobilnych.

Dlatego stworzenie podstawowej aplikacji ze standardowymi funkcjami nie sprawi, że Twoja aplikacja będzie się wyróżniać.

Aby pomóc Twojej aplikacji wyprzedzać konkurencję, tak jak większość firm, musisz zacząć uwzględniać najnowsze trendy i technologie tworzenia aplikacji.

Na początku musisz być świadomy najnowszych trendów i technik tworzenia aplikacji mobilnych, aby stworzyć skuteczny plan rozwoju aplikacji, który będzie skuteczny. Doprowadzi to do rozwoju aplikacji, które odniosą sukces.

Przyjrzyjmy się najpierw statystykom i powodom, dla których tworzenie aplikacji jest niezbędne, a także temu, co stanie się z tworzeniem aplikacji w najbliższej przyszłości oraz temu, jak ludzie będą nadal korzystać z aplikacji. Z pewnością pomoże Ci w tworzeniu pomocnych aplikacji.

Dlaczego ludzie będą nadal korzystać z aplikacji mobilnych: poznaj motywy

Użytkownicy prawdopodobnie przyciągną Twoją aplikację, jeśli uznają, że Twoja aplikacja mobilna:

Bardzo przydatne

Aplikacja, której używasz, może mieć funkcje podobne do innych, jednak musisz odkryć, czego nie ma Twoja aplikacja. Rozważ dodanie funkcji, których nie mają inne aplikacje. Dodatkowo korzystaj z najnowszych technologii i narzędzi, aby wyróżnić swoją aplikację.

Prosty w użyciu

Aplikacja, której wybierzesz, powinna mieć przejrzystą szatę graficzną, jasny cel i być prosta w użyciu. Ponadto musisz być świadomy potrzeb użytkowników i z łatwością na nie odpowiadać. Upewnij się, że Twoja aplikacja opiera się na tych podstawowych funkcjach.

Ujmujący

Wszyscy wiemy, że pierwsze wrażenie trwa dłużej. Ponadto Twoja aplikacja musi być wciągająca, szczególnie na pierwszych ekranach. Zadecyduje, czy klienci są zadowoleni, czy nie.

Zwiększ zaangażowanie użytkowników (również offline)

Korzystaj z najlepszych przypomnień lub wiadomości push, aby przypomnieć użytkownikom o wartości Twojej aplikacji i pomóc użytkownikom zintegrować ją z ich intensywnym życiem.

Szybkie i skuteczne

Użytkownicy doceniają szybkie i niezawodne aplikacje. Dlatego upewnij się, że Twoja aplikacja jest instalowana szybko i działa szybciej.

Użyj przyjaznej dla użytkownika strategii zarabiania

Wybierz sposoby zarabiania, które ułatwią użytkownikom. Dzięki opcji zakupów w aplikacji wykwalifikowani twórcy aplikacji zazwyczaj wybierają model zakupów w aplikacji, który jest bezpłatny.

Nie używaj wielu opcji płatności w aplikacji, ponieważ mogą one wprowadzić użytkowników w błąd.

Akceptuj opinie i recenzje

Pozwól użytkownikom zostawiać recenzje i opinie , a następnie spróbuj rozwiązać te problemy. Wysłuchaj sugestii klientów, a następnie spróbuj je wdrożyć.

Przyszłe trendy i technologie tworzenia aplikacji

Poniżej przedstawiamy listę nowych trendów, o których należy pamiętać podczas projektowania aplikacji.

1. Integracja z internetem rzeczy i chmurą

Przetwarzanie w chmurze oraz IoT to dwie nowe technologie.

Zasadniczo przetwarzanie w chmurze jest sposobem na wspieranie IoT poprzez działanie jako front-end aplikacji. Opiera się na idei umożliwienia użytkownikom wykonywania zadań obliczeniowych za pomocą usług świadczonych przez Internet.

IoT i integracja mobilna tworzą nowe aplikacje i inteligentne usługi, takie jak baza danych jako usługa (DBaaS), a także wykrywanie jako usługa (SaaS) i nadzór wideo jako usługa (VSaaS) i wiele innych.

Połączona chmura IoT i IoT są wykorzystywane w rzeczywistych aplikacjach, takich jak nadzór wideo i inteligentne miasto w rolnictwie, opieka zdrowotna i inteligentne liczniki oraz inteligentny dom.

Integracja IoT Cloud ułatwia zarządzanie przechowywaniem i przetwarzaniem danych, usprawnia procesy, usprawnia współpracę, zwiększa wydajność, zmniejsza koszty hostingu, przyspiesza integrację i instalację oraz zmniejsza koszty przetwarzania danych i skomplikowaną wydajność.

2. Sztuczna inteligencja w przyszłych aplikacjach mobilnych

Sztuczna inteligencja pozostanie nowym trendem w tworzeniu aplikacji. Sztuczna inteligencja odgrywa kluczową rolę w procesie rozwoju, ponieważ oferuje bardziej spersonalizowane wrażenia z aplikacji, które spełniają wymagania użytkowników. Przewiduje się, że w 2023 r. globalne przychody z rynku oprogramowania związanego z AI wyniosą 70,94 mld USD.

Przewidujemy, że w niedalekiej przyszłości wiele aplikacji AI zostanie opracowanych za pomocą technologii, takich jak analityka predykcyjna i algorytmy uczenia maszynowego.

Twórcy aplikacji mogą oferować bardziej spersonalizowane wrażenia użytkownika, które pozwolą sztucznej inteligencji na podejmowanie wymaganych działań bez wpływu na wcześniejsze działania i nawyki użytkownika.

Aplikacje, które mogą zawierać funkcje AI, obejmują wykrywanie twarzy, zdolność rozpoznawania mowy, obrazów, klasyfikacji obrazów i tekstów, konserwację nakazową i wiele innych.

3. Swift, język przyszłego tworzenia aplikacji

W przyszłości oczekuje się, że język programowania Swift będzie odgrywał ważną rolę. Jest to powód, dla którego jest dobrze znany jako trend mobilny, który zwiększa szybkość tworzenia aplikacji i zmniejsza ogólny koszt tworzenia aplikacji.

Wielu programistów aplikacji na iOS używa Swifta do tworzenia aplikacji. Język Swift oferuje możliwości, których inni programiści nie uwzględnili w połączeniu z językami ojczystymi.

Język programowania Swift ma funkcję Interactive Playgrounds, która pozwala programistom modyfikować kod bez ponownej kompilacji lub naprawiania błędów.

Domyślne typy i automatyczne zarządzanie pamięcią to jedne z najlepszych cech Swift. Możliwe jest również łączenie języków Swift i Objective-C. Dlatego programiści nie muszą używać aplikacji Objective-C na iPady lub iPhone'y.

4. Rola AR i VR w przyszłości

W 2021 r. rynki AR, VR i rzeczywistości mieszanej osiągnęły wartość 30,7 mld USD, a w 2024 r. dogonią 300 mld USD.

Poinformowano, że do końca 2026 roku zmieni się funkcjonowanie gier mobilnych i aplikacji mobilnych. Większość ludzi przechodzi z komputerów PC na AR/VR, a nawet ujawnia pewne postępy w handlu biletami, oglądaniu, minigrach i tak dalej.

Zmodyfikowana, oparta na rzeczywistości wersja rzeczywistości rozszerzonej została stworzona przy użyciu elementów generowanych komputerowo, które zostały wstawione do obrazu. W tym celu aplikacje AR wykorzystują informacje o geolokalizacji, kody QR czy funkcję rozpoznawania obiektów.

Dodatkowo system, który wymaga zestawu słuchawkowego i jest całkowicie zaangażowany w generowaną komputerowo rzeczywistość.

Integracja technologii VR i AR w projektach aplikacji w dowolnej branży daje programistom szansę na stworzenie bardziej spersonalizowanego doświadczenia użytkownika.

Najnowsze trendy w AR/VR obejmują występy na żywo i wirtualne symulatory treningowe, metody uczenia się, nawigatory miejsc docelowych i wiele innych.

Najnowsze technologie wykorzystywane do tworzenia aplikacji stale poprawiają możliwości i wydajność, aw niedalekiej przyszłości technologia pomoże w opracowywaniu aplikacji podróżniczych, aplikacji do gier, a także aplikacji do transmisji na żywo.

5. Wieloplatformowe tworzenie przyszłych aplikacji

W zależności od konkretnych potrzeb biznesowych technologia, której używasz w swojej aplikacji, może się różnić. Jeśli chcesz szybciej opracować aplikację gotową do wprowadzenia na rynek i mającą wiele funkcji, powinieneś wybrać programowanie międzyplatformowe.

W przyszłości trendy w rozwoju aplikacji będą wymagały rozwoju w taki sposób, aby aplikacje mobilne mogły być wykorzystywane na różnych platformach urządzeń mobilnych (Windows, Android, iOS itp.).

Narzędzia do programowania na różnych platformach, takie jak NativeScript, React Native, Xamarin i inne, mają do odegrania kluczową rolę w branży tworzenia aplikacji. Dodatkowo mogą pomóc w obniżeniu kosztów i poprawie szybkości rozwoju.

6. Technologia 5G

Przewiduje się, że technologia bezprzewodowa 5G zmieni krajobraz tworzenia aplikacji. Ponieważ 5G przyniesie niesamowitą prędkość, chwyta klucze do luksusowego stylu życia w najbliższej przyszłości.

Oprócz szybkości sieci i szybkości sieci, technologia ta zrewolucjonizuje gry AR/VR, gry 3D, bezpieczeństwo danych i inne aspekty aplikacji.

Dzięki tej technologii wiele aplikacji, takich jak inteligentne miasta, łańcuch dostaw IoT, AR/VR, transport itp., może czerpać korzyści w różnych branżach.

7. Łańcuch bloków

Zgodnie z przewidywaniami światowe przychody z blockchain wzrosną do około 39 miliardów dolarów do 2025 roku. Technologie integracji Blockchain zmienią sposób tworzenia i wdrażania aplikacji.

Na początku technologia blockchain była znana ze swojej niezawodności i stabilności wszystkich kryptowalut. Obecnie jest wykorzystywana jako baza danych dla prawie każdej aplikacji, takiej jak aplikacja fintech lub aplikacja detaliczna, aplikacje zdrowotne i wiele innych.

Jest to niescentralizowana księga, która pomaga w śledzeniu transakcji wielu stron, które są udostępniane każdemu udziałowcowi. Dzięki temu system jest bardziej przejrzysty i zwiększa bezpieczeństwo aplikacji, ponieważ blokuje oszukańcze transakcje, a także nie zezwala na żadne zmiany w transakcjach, dopóki interesariusze nie będą świadomi zmian.

Dodatkowo technologia ta działa najskuteczniej w przypadku transakcji typu peer-to-peer. Dzieje się tak, ponieważ pomaga w utrzymywaniu dokładnych i wiarygodnych danych transakcji, które są oparte na wymaganiach aplikacji.

Z perspektywy IT blockchain ma kluczowe znaczenie dla firm i powinien być połączony z innymi istniejącymi systemami zaplecza, aby uzyskać lepsze wyniki.

W niedalekiej przyszłości narzędzia do integracji blockchain będą mogły z łatwością udostępniać i komunikować zasoby cyfrowe.

8. Urządzenia do noszenia

W 2021 roku światowa populacja użytkowników końcowych korzystających z urządzeń do noszenia wynosiła około 81,5 miliarda dolarów. W 2022 roku liczba ta prawdopodobnie wyniesie 90 miliardów dolarów.

Od raportów zdrowotnych, przez statystyki, po codzienne informacje o naszym zdrowiu psychicznym, integracja technologii ubieralnych odgrywa ważną rolę w naszym codziennym życiu.

Urządzenia nadające się do noszenia mogą zaowocować wydajnymi rutynowymi zadaniami. Ponadto włączenie ich do tworzenia aplikacji mogłoby ułatwić życie użytkownikom, umożliwiając im korzystanie z aplikacji.

Technologia zapewni różne opcje w różnych sektorach, w tym aplikacje zdrowotne, aplikacje fitness i wiele innych, gdy zostanie zintegrowana z innymi aplikacjami.

Dlatego oczekuje się, że technologiczne urządzenia do noszenia będą miały znaczący wpływ na kolejne projekty i rozwój aplikacji.

Przyszłość natywnych aplikacji mobilnych

Wiele firm korzysta z natywnej aplikacji mobilnej. Jest to platforma dla oprogramowania działającego na określonym gadżecie i systemie operacyjnym. Te aplikacje nie są kompatybilne z przeglądarkami, zamiast tego musisz je pobrać ze sklepów z aplikacjami. Następnie te aplikacje są teraz gotowe do użycia.

Aplikacje natywne są bezpieczne, łatwe w zarządzaniu i działają najlepiej. Jest przyjazny dla użytkownika i wciągający. Łapie również mniej błędów w procesie rozwoju, jest przystępny cenowo, elastyczny i opłacalny, a także może działać w trybie offline.

Przyszłość aplikacji natywnych jest jasna , ponieważ może kosztować więcej niż inne aplikacje , ale jest warta wysiłku ze względu na korzyści, jakie przynosi.